Detectives from the Sacramento Sheriff's Department are investigating a shooting that took place this morning that left one man dead.  

A little before 4:00 a.m., the Sheriff’s Communication Center received a 911 call regarding a man down on the street in the area of 43rd Avenue and Franklin Boulevard in South Sacramento.


Deputies responded to the scene and located an unidentified male victim suffering from multiple gunshot wounds. The victim was pronounced deceased at the scene. 

Homicide detectives responded to the scene, and are looking for any witnesses to the event. Residents in the area reported hearing multiple gunshots just before 4:00 a.m. 

There is no known motive or suspect description at this time. The identity of the victim in this case will be made available by the Sacramento County Coroner’s office, after notification has been made to his next of kin.
